2012 National Stationery Show at the Javits Center in New York City

It is the third year for Max and BunNY at the New York National Stationery Show at the Javits Center in New York City.  Becca Hardie, designer, showed off her new line of Christmas Cards, Valentine Cards, a new birthday card and Wrapping Paper Kit in a eye popping corner booth.  The Max and BunNY booth had its traditional gray side walls and bright color design back wall.  We helped with the setup, and as you can see, it was beautiful!

Cover Girl!

January 15, 2012 by shelley

Becca’s card design “Links” (her company is Max and BunNY) made the cover of Stationery Trends Magazine, winter issue.  Stationery Trends is the industry’s resource for greeting cards, gifts and all things stationery.  Stationery Trends magazine seeks to guide stationery retailers in their quest to offer the latest designs and trends to their customers- including everything from stationery and greeting cards to gifts.  The design-focused trade magazine provides retailers with a peek at some of the industry’s hottest designers and most sought-after products.  Stationery Trends reports on upcoming trends before they hit the mainstream, ensuring its audience of diverse retailers is always ahead of the curve.
